Odd Site for Orange Bowl?
Orange Bowl officials, fearing a possible conflict with the NFL playoffs at Pro Player Stadium, need an alternative site for their game Jan. 2. As a result, the Orange Bowl may be returning to the Orange Bowl.
The game moved to Pro Player Stadium two seasons ago. But the prospect of a wild-card playoff game hosted by the Miami Dolphins on Jan. 2 means this season’s game may be back to its namesake home near downtown Miami.

Brian Gray returned an interception 39 yards for a touchdown on the game’s fourth play, and the Brigham Young defense held its ground on a wet, slippery field Thursday night in a 13-0 victory over San Diego State at Provo, Utah.
